What Is Customized Hardware Sheet Metal Processing?
Customized hardware sheet metal processing refers to the process of transforming metal sheets into designed products through cutting, bending, forming, welding, finishing, and assembly. The process is widely used in industries that need special metal structures instead of ready-made products.
Common customized sheet metal products include:
- Electrical equipment cabinets and control boxes
- Machine covers and protective frames
- Metal brackets and supports
- Industrial equipment parts
- Commercial display structures
- Automotive and electronic components
A professional manufacturer focuses on combining customer drawings, product functions, and production requirements to create accurate and practical solutions.
Important Design Considerations for Customized Sheet Metal Parts
Good design is the foundation of successful sheet metal manufacturing. Design-driven customized hardware sheet metal processing focuses on creating products that are not only attractive but also easy to manufacture, assemble, and maintain.
When preparing a sheet metal design, customers should consider the following points:
- Product size and shape: The dimensions should match the installation environment and usage requirements.
- Material thickness: The thickness affects strength, weight, and production cost.
- Bending requirements: Proper bending design helps avoid cracks and improves product durability.
- Assembly needs: Consider holes, slots, fasteners, and connection methods during the design stage.
- Surface requirements: Decide whether the product needs painting, powder coating, polishing, or other finishing methods.
For example, an industrial equipment manufacturer may need a protective metal enclosure that can withstand vibration and dust. A well-planned design can improve protection while keeping production costs reasonable.
Choosing the Right Materials for Sheet Metal Processing
Material selection directly affects product performance, appearance, and price. Material-optimized customized hardware sheet metal processing helps customers choose suitable materials according to their working environment and budget.
Common sheet metal materials include:
- Stainless steel: Suitable for applications requiring corrosion resistance, strength, and a clean appearance.
- Carbon steel: A cost-effective choice for general industrial parts and structures.
- Aluminum: Lightweight and suitable for products that need easy transportation or heat resistance.
- Galvanized steel: Provides better protection against rust for many outdoor applications.
The best material depends on factors such as operating conditions, required strength, production quantity, and final product purpose. Experienced manufacturers can provide suggestions to balance performance and cost.
Main Manufacturing Processes in Customized Hardware Sheet Metal Processing
Modern sheet metal production uses several processes to turn flat metal sheets into finished components. A reliable manufacturer combines advanced equipment with skilled workers to achieve stable results.
1. Cutting
Cutting is the first step in creating the basic shape of a metal part. Common methods include laser cutting, shearing, and other precision cutting technologies. Accurate cutting improves the following bending and assembly processes.
2. Bending and Forming
Bending changes flat metal sheets into three-dimensional shapes. Proper bending methods help maintain product strength and appearance while reducing material waste.
3. Welding and Assembly
Welding connects different metal pieces to create stronger structures. Careful welding ensures stable connections and improves product reliability.
4. Surface Treatment
Surface finishing improves appearance and protects products from corrosion, scratches, and environmental damage. Common treatments include powder coating, painting, polishing, and plating.
How Quality Control Ensures Reliable Sheet Metal Products
Quality control is one of the most important parts of high-quality customized hardware sheet metal processing. A professional supplier should have clear inspection procedures throughout the manufacturing process.
Important quality checks include:
- Checking raw material quality before production
- Inspecting cutting accuracy and product dimensions
- Checking bending angles and assembly accuracy
- Testing welding strength and surface quality
- Performing final inspections before shipment
For example, a custom electrical cabinet supplier must ensure that dimensions are accurate because even a small error can affect equipment installation. Strict quality management helps prevent delays and additional costs.

Common Applications of Customized Hardware Sheet Metal Processing
Application-specific customized hardware sheet metal processing supports many industries because each field has different product requirements.
- Industrial automation: Metal frames, machine covers, and equipment cabinets.
- Electronics: Enclosures for control systems, instruments, and devices.
- Medical equipment: Precision metal structures requiring clean surfaces and reliable performance.
- Energy industry: Protective boxes and structural components.
- Commercial equipment: Display stands, cabinets, and customized hardware products.
For example, a technology company developing a new device may require a special metal enclosure that cannot be purchased from standard suppliers. Customized processing allows the company to create a product that matches its design and market needs.
